Possible policy routes
The task name alone cannot decide it.
A published workplace policy can return different answers for the same task. These are the practical branches worth encoding.
A routine policy route may be possible
The company can consider a standard route where the exact account is approved, only the minimum employee personal information is used, a reference draft remains within the stated purpose, and people policy owner reviews it before use.
Approval may be required
A named reviewer should take over when the account or data handling is uncertain, the draft may disclose unapproved information or make unsupported judgements, or a reference draft reaches people or systems beyond the requester’s authority.
The request may need to stop or change
The policy may require another method where restricted information would enter an unapproved service, the output would act before people policy owner can intervene, or follow the approved reference scope and verify every factual statement cannot be maintained. Consider less information, a controlled account or a non-AI process.

Useful safeguards
Controls that fit this request
- ✓
Follow the approved reference scope and verify every factual statement
- ✓
Keep whole files, mailboxes and datasets out of the prompt when a short part of verified employment details and the company reference policy is enough.
- ✓
Treat a new purpose, region, data source or recipient as a new request rather than silently extending this one.
- ✓
Link the completed check to the applicable policy version and append later reassessments separately.
